Practices at CentreVida during delivery and in the immediate postpartum period are structured to give you and your baby      the important elements needed for establishing a successful breastfeeding relationship. These include:

  • Immediate skin-to-skin contact
  • No separation of mom and baby
  • No invasive procedures during first hour including cutting of the umbilical cord
  • Assistance with "baby led" latch in the first hour

 

Baby Signs Classes

Sign language is a great way to communicate with your child and has proved to have other benefits including earlier language development, increased self confidence and self esteem, as well as reducing aggressive behavior.
